Maintenance Electrician

Bath

£35'000 - £37,694 + Days based role + Potential Progression to £41,064 + 3.5% Callout Allowance + Double-Time Callouts + Overtime + Excellent Pension + 39 Days Holiday

In this role, you'll carry out planned and reactive electrical maintenance across a large estate, working on lighting, power distribution and a variety of building services equipment. You'll be working in an organised environment where work is planned, expectations are clear and the focus is on delivering quality rather than constantly rushing from job to job.

The ideal candidate will be a qualified Electrician with an NVQ Level 3 or equivalent and experience within maintenance, facilities or building services. Alongside a salary of up to £37,694, you'll receive a 3.5% callout allowance, callouts paid at double time, opportunities for overtime, an excellent salary-sacrifice pension and 39 days' annual leave. There is also longer-term earning potential through the organisation's Outstanding Contribution Scheme, which can increase the current salary ceiling to £41,064 for employees meeting the relevant criteria.

The Role:
*Planned and reactive electrical maintenance
*Working across lighting, power distribution and building services
*Electrical fault finding, testing and repairs
*Supporting small installation and improvement works
*Technically varied work across a large, well-maintained site
*Monday-Friday, 37-hour working week
*8:30am-5:00pm
*3.5% callout allowance
*Callouts paid at double time - minimum 2 hours, or 3 hours after midnight
*Additional overtime opportunities where operationally required
The Person:
*NVQ Level 3 in Electrical Installation or equivalent
*18th Edition preferred
*Electrical maintenance or building services experience
*Strong fault-finding ability
*Looking for a stable, site-based position
*Values work-life balance and a positive, collaborative team culture
*Takes pride in delivering high-quality work
